Environmentally Safe & Chemical FREE Laundry Alternatives


  1. Throw away any and all commercial Fabric Softeners, you don't need them! A cotton or muslin bag filled with Lavender Flowers works even better. Toss bag in the dryer with each load. Use 1/2 cup to 1 cup of Lavender Flowers per bag full, and that's all you need for a reusable & natural alternative. Each cotton/muslin baggy will usually last 20 to 30 loads or more. The savings & other benefits are substantial.
  2. Vinegar is a necessity in all laundry rooms! Use common distilled vinegar in your washer as a bleach alternative & color booster. Vinegar also works well as a pretreatment on tough stains. Use approx. 2 Tbsp in every load to ensure added softness and guarantee the antibacterial properties. For heavily soiled items and/or loads add 1/2 cup to your wash.
  3. Make your own linen spray. You two can have a custom or aromatherapy spray for your linens and clothing. Take a few drops of your favorite pure essential oil(s) and add them to a spray bottle full of distilled water. Shake bottle well before each use.  **Never used fragranced oils, only pure essential oils!)
  4. Next time you wash your delicates, skip the dryer. hang all your goddess wear out or up to dry some place warm or where there is dry air flow. You'll be amazed at the savings on your electric bill!
